Output 08300ec3683f5bf24ad5fd36eb4ea912216fb61401d3f0f59701229cc94d708b:0

value
2325244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db21eea328ec3aef23e9a162f1fb76177c0aad24 OP_EQUAL
address
3MfgZCmDHiuo73RKf5DZi1p17AT7ttmxUA
transaction
08300ec3683f5bf24ad5fd36eb4ea912216fb61401d3f0f59701229cc94d708b
confirmations
212331
spent
true